In April, eighteen ASQ members (ASQ Executive and non-Executive) gathered at DeVry (after work) to go through the Strategic Planning Process, facilitated by Jim Roscoe, Government of Alberta.
ASQ Executive Committee was pleasantly surprised by the overwhelming support from the ASQ community when a request to participate in shaping the future of ASQ Calgary was posted on the ASQ website. On 18th Nov, Dr Alastair Muir presented a City of Calgary improvement project at the Canadian Danish Club. It was well received by ASQ members and non-members.
From the record number of people registering for this dinner event, the organizer knew the interest and expectation were high on this topic "Lean Six Sigma & Politics". Dr Alastair Muir delivered an engaging session, meeting or exceeding 97% of attendees' expectation.
